首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何引用另一个视图同级作为数据绑定中的适配器参数

在云计算领域,引用另一个视图同级作为数据绑定中的适配器参数是指在前端开发中,通过适配器将数据源与视图进行绑定,以实现数据的展示和交互。当需要引用同级视图作为适配器参数时,可以按照以下步骤进行操作:

  1. 确定数据源:首先需要确定数据源,可以是一个数组、一个对象或者一个接口返回的数据。
  2. 创建适配器:根据数据源的类型,创建一个适配器对象。适配器负责将数据源中的数据转换为视图所需的格式。
  3. 引用同级视图:在数据绑定的过程中,可以通过引用同级视图作为适配器参数来实现数据的展示。具体的方法和语法可能因使用的前端框架或库而有所不同,以下是一些常见的方法:
    • Vue.js:可以使用v-for指令来循环渲染同级视图,并将适配器作为参数传递给v-for指令。例如:
    • Vue.js:可以使用v-for指令来循环渲染同级视图,并将适配器作为参数传递给v-for指令。例如:
    • React:可以使用map方法来循环渲染同级视图,并将适配器作为参数传递给map方法。例如:
    • React:可以使用map方法来循环渲染同级视图,并将适配器作为参数传递给map方法。例如:
    • Angular:可以使用ngFor指令来循环渲染同级视图,并将适配器作为参数传递给ngFor指令。例如:
    • Angular:可以使用ngFor指令来循环渲染同级视图,并将适配器作为参数传递给ngFor指令。例如:
  • 数据绑定:将适配器与数据源进行绑定,以实现数据的动态更新。具体的方法和语法也可能因使用的前端框架或库而有所不同,以下是一些常见的方法:
    • Vue.js:可以使用computed属性或watch属性来监听数据源的变化,并更新适配器。例如:
    • Vue.js:可以使用computed属性或watch属性来监听数据源的变化,并更新适配器。例如:
    • React:可以使用useStateuseEffect钩子函数来监听数据源的变化,并更新适配器。例如:
    • React:可以使用useStateuseEffect钩子函数来监听数据源的变化,并更新适配器。例如:
    • Angular:可以使用ngOnChange生命周期钩子函数来监听数据源的变化,并更新适配器。例如:
    • Angular:可以使用ngOnChange生命周期钩子函数来监听数据源的变化,并更新适配器。例如:

以上是引用另一个视图同级作为数据绑定中的适配器参数的一般步骤和示例代码。具体的实现方式和语法可能因使用的前端框架或库而有所不同。在腾讯云的产品中,可以使用云函数 SCF(Serverless Cloud Function)来实现数据的动态更新和适配器的生成。SCF 是一种无服务器计算服务,可以帮助开发者在云端运行代码,无需关心服务器的运维和扩展。您可以通过腾讯云 SCF 的官方文档了解更多信息:腾讯云 SCF 产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

提示 Data Binding 库使用经验教训

Data Binding 库(下文中以『DB 库』词语来指代)提供了一个灵活强大方式来绑定数据到 UI 界面。...幸运是,『DB 库』为我们提供了一个手工方式去在 binding adapter 接收状态。通过提供参数两次:第一个参数接收当前值,第二个参数接收新值。...这是一个展示 Tivi(链接)样例: 你可以看到它仅仅是一个简单数据类,包含了 UI 需要在一个 TV 秀界面上显示所有细节 UI 元素。...这就是为什么让视图绑定变得高效非常重要。...所以如果你 UI 也有大量 RecyclerView 组成,你可以类似上文描述不费事地获取计算这方面的优化。 小步迭代 希望这篇文章强调了一些可以优化数据绑定实现方案一些小事。

69120

Data Binding 库使用经验教训

但是要用一句陈词滥调:『能力越大,责任越大』,仅仅是使用数据绑定,并不意味着你可以避免成为一个优秀 UI 开发者。...幸运是,『DB 库』为我们提供了一个手工方式去在 binding adapter 接收状态。通过提供参数两次:第一个参数接收当前值,第二个参数接收新值。...这是一个展示 Tivi(链接)样例: 你可以看到它仅仅是一个简单数据类,包含了 UI 需要在一个 TV 秀界面上显示所有细节 UI 元素。...这就是为什么让视图绑定变得高效非常重要。...所以如果你 UI 也有大量 RecyclerView 组成,你可以类似上文描述不费事地获取计算这方面的优化。 小步迭代 希望这篇文章强调了一些可以优化数据绑定实现方案一些小事。

42420
  • 为什么说Flutter让移动开发变得更好?

    让我们从在Android构建此列表所需步骤开始: 用XML创建list-item布局文件 创建一个适配器绑定视图并设置数据 为列表创建布局(可能在Activity或Fragment) 填充Fragment.../Activity列表布局 在Fragment / Activity创建适配器,布局管理器等实例 在后台线程上从网络下载电影数据 回到主线程设置适配器项目 现在需要考虑保存和恢复列表状态等细节...下面看看如何在Flutter实现上面的例子: 为电影项目创建一个无状态Widget(无状态,因为包含静态属性),接收一个movie(例如Dart类)作为构造函数参数,并以声明方式描述布局,同时绑定电影值...Flutter使用Databinding相同思想,即将视图/小部件绑定到变量,而无需在Java / Kotlin手动管理数据绑定,不用专门绑定文件来桥接XML和Java。...这也引出了状态管理问题,并提出了一个问题:当绑定数据发生了变化应该怎么处理? 手动获取相应视图引用并设置新值? 这种方法真的很容易出错,这样管理View状态很差劲。

    2K10

    关于Spring 和 Spring MVC43个问题【问题汇总】

    视图渲染将模型数据(在ModelAndView对象)填充到request域 第十一步:前端控制器向用户响应结果 9.web.xml配置 ? 10.注解处理器映射器和适配器?...作用:将model数据填充到request域。 2 简单类型 通过@RequestParam对简单类型参数进行绑定。...3 pojo绑定 页面inputname和controllerpojo形参属性名称一致,将页面数据绑定到pojo。...数组绑定: controller方法参数使用:(Integer[] itemId) 页面统一使用:itemId 作为name 2). list绑定: pojo属性名为:itemsList...也可以说,依赖被注入到对象。所以,控制反转是,关于一个对象如何获取他所依赖对象引用,这个责任反转。 41.spring有两种代理方式?

    2.2K10

    SpringMvc工作原理

    (本章暂不介绍):用于将请求参数转换到命令对象属性对应类型   6.7 @RequestBody(重要~~~~~):用于目前比较流行ajax开发数据绑定(即提交数据类型为json格式) 7....      注:required设置成false参数类型必须是引用类型,因为基本数据类型是不能为null   6.4 @ModelAttribute:请求参数到命令对象绑定 常用参数:value...6.4.1 可用@ModelAttribute标注方法参数,方法参数会被添加到Model对象(作用:向视图层传数据)     6.4.2 可用@ModelAttribute标注一个非请求处理方法...,此方法会在每次调用请求处理方法前被调用(作用:数据初始化)     6.4.3 可用@ModelAttribute标注方法,方法返回值会被添加到Model对象(作用:向视图层传数据) 但此方法视图逻辑图就会根据请求路径解析...  @RequestHeader:请求头(header)数据到处理器功能处理方法方法参数绑定   @RequestBody:请求body体绑定(通过HttpMessageConverter

    1.1K10

    SpringMVC01之入门

    required、defaultValue       注:required设置成false参数类型必须是引用类型,因为基本数据类型是不能为null  6.4 @ModelAttribute...:请求参数到命令对象绑定       常用参数:value     6.4.1 可用@ModelAttribute标注方法参数,方法参数会被添加到Model对象(作用:向视图层传数据)    ...Model对象(作用:向视图层传数据)           但此方法视图逻辑图就会根据请求路径解析,例如:a/test42 --> /WEB-INF/a/test42.jsp          ...@RequestHeader:请求头(header)数据到处理器功能处理方法方法参数绑定 @RequestBody:请求body体绑定(通过HttpMessageConverter进行类型转换...; @ExceptionHandler:注解式声明异常处理器; @PathVariable:请求URI模板变量部分到处理器功能处理方法方法参数绑定 7.

    1.2K20

    ListView详细介绍与使用

    工作原理 ListView 仅是作为容器(列表),用于装载显示数据(就是上面的一个个红色框内容,也称为 item)。item 具体数据是由适配器(adapter)来提供。...适配器(adapter):作为 View (不仅仅指 ListView)和数据之间桥梁或者中介,将数据映射到要展示 View 。这就是最简单适配器模式,也是适配器主要作用!...解决方案: 为了节省内存占用,ListView 是不会为每一条数据创建一个视图,而是采用了 Recycler组件 方式。回收和复用 View。 那么是如何来复用呢?...ArrayAdapter:简单、易用 Adapter,用于将数组数据作为数据绑定到列表项。...形式数据绑定到列表作为数据源,支持泛型操作 步骤: 在 xml 文件布局上实现 ListView 在 Activity 定义数据源(列表或者数组) 构造 ArrayAdapter 对象,设置适配器

    1.5K20

    Wgpu图文详解(01)窗口与基本渲染

    在本例,此时我们需要修改一下方法pub fn new() -> Self参数签名,使其能够接受一个winit::window::Window窗体引用作为参数,稍后调用地方,我们会将前面在App创建窗口传入到此处...PS:后文还会介绍另一个与surface表面相关重要概念,请读者继续耐心阅读 适配器与逻辑设备、命令队列 目前为止,我们通过surface来抽象了一个绘制目标,这个目标目前是与我们窗口相绑定。...答案就是通过调用Surfaceget_default_configAPI获取: 该API传入3个参数(忽略&self),其中,第一个参数需要传入硬件适配器adapter引用,这里具体原因暂不讨论,...wgpu::Surface,说明这个类型结构体内部是包含了关于窗口引用(该结构体具有名为'window生命周期参数),也就是说,这个surface字段数据存活周期不能超过窗口本身...上面我们解释了纹理基本作用:存储图像数据基本资源(1、2、3维数据,高度图、法线贴图)。而纹理视图是对纹理资源一种解释方式或视角。它允许你指定如何访问纹理一部分或以特定方式解释纹理数据

    24621

    【Android从零单排系列四十七】《Android自定义adapter实现方法》

    适配器通常用于列表、网格及其他可滚动视图数据绑定适配器主要作用包括: 数据转换:适配器将原始数据源转换为可以在 UI 控件展示数据项。...视图创建:适配器负责根据数据布局要求创建相应 UI 视图元素,并提供给父容器进行显示。 数据绑定适配器数据内容绑定到相应 UI 视图上,确保正确地显示数据。...ArrayAdapter:是 BaseAdapter 子类,适用于简单数据集合,它将数组或列表每个项都作为一个单一文本视图显示。...绑定数据视图:在适配器 getView() 方法,将数据项与对应视图进行绑定。...使用视图元素方法(如 TextView、ImageView 等)获取相应 UI 控件,并将数据内容设置到对应控件上。 提供数据源:适配器通常需要有一个数据作为输入,提供给适配器使用。

    35110

    C# 一个基于.NET Core3.1开源项目帮你彻底搞懂WPF框架Prism

    --概述 这个项目演示了如何在WPF中使用各种Prism功能示例。如果您刚刚开始使用Prism,建议您从第一个示例开始,按顺序从列表开始。每个示例都基于前一个示例概念。...作为单个命令调用多个命令 IActiveAware Commands 使您命令IActiveAware仅调用激活命令 Event Aggregator 使用IEventAggregator Event...Views 导航期间控制视图实例 Passing Parameters 将参数视图/视图模型传递到另一个视图/视图模型 Confirm/cancel Navigation 使用IConfirmNavigationReqest...界面确认或取消导航 Controlling View lifetime 使用IRegionMemberLifetime自动从内存删除视图 Navigation Journal 了解如何使用导航日志...SendMessageCommand}" Content="Send Message" Margin="5"/> MessageViewModel.cs:在vm把界面绑定命令委托给

    1.6K20

    系统分析师章节练习错题知识点

    逻辑视图表示了涉及模型在架构方面具有重要意义部分,即类、子系统、包和用例实现子集。 进程视图是可执行线程和进程作为活动类建模。 实现视图对组成基于系统物理代码文件建模。...创建一个ConcreteCommand对象并设定它接收者; 类invoke要求Command执行这个请求; 类Receiver知道如何实施与执行一个请求相关操作,任何类都可能作为一个接收着。...在“点菜”这个实例,订单是厨师(Cook)与action(按订单加工)之间绑定,厨师接受订单并对其进行负责。...在实际应用,很少使用泛化关系,子用例特殊行为都可以作为父用例备选事件流而存在。 进程视图是以可执行线程和进程作为活动类建模,它描述了并发与同步结构。...系统设计---设计模式 适配器模式(Adapter):适配器模式将一个接口转换成客户希望另一个接口,从而使接口不兼容那些类可以一起工作。适配器模式既可以作为类结构型模式,也可以作为对象结构型模式。

    27730

    javaweb-springMVC-54

    ,path method 属性 params: headers: 请求参数绑定 javabean完成数据封装 请求参数中文乱码解决 自定义类型转换器 获得serverlet原生api 常用注解...(Command 请求参数绑定对象就叫命令对象) 表单对象(Form Object 提供给表单展示和提交到对象就叫表单对象)。...在 SpringMVC 各个组件,处理器映射器、处理器适配器视图解析器称为 SpringMVC 三大组件。 ?...因此在之前spring.xml只需要再配置视图解析器就完成了 我们只需要编写处理具体业务控制器以及视图。 ?...要求必须参数 headers: 用于指定限制请求消息头条件 请求参数绑定 拿到请求数据 按照既定方式直接填充 类 ? ? jsp ?

    59020

    Spring MVC 到底是如何工作

    ;@GetMapping("/")public String hello() { return "login"; } 为了处理用户登录,需要创建另一个用登录数据处理POST请求方法。...Flash映射基本上是一种模式,该模式将参数从一个请求传递到另一个紧跟请求。...有超过30个不同参数解析器实现。它们允许从请求中提取任何类型信息,并将其作为方法参数提供。这包括URL路径变量,请求主体参数,请求标头,cookies,会话数据等。...它基于模型和封装在ModelAndView对象选定视图来完成。 另外请注意,我们可以呈现JSON对象,或XML,或任何可通过HTTP协议传输其他数据格式。...在渲染过程,ModelAndView对象可能已经包含对所选视图引用,或者只是一个视图名称,或者如果控制器依赖于默认视图,则什么都没有。

    1.4K30

    【Android从零单排系列二十】《Android视图控件——ListView》

    数据源:ListView通过与适配器(Adapter)配合使用来提供数据适配器负责将数据与每个列表项进行绑定,以便正确渲染和展示。...可以在布局文件添加控件来显示列表项各个元素。 添加数据:通过适配器向ListView添加数据,可以使用适配器方法(如add()、addAll())添加单个或多个数据项。...ArrayAdapter:ArrayAdapter是基于数组简单适配器,用于将数据与ListView绑定。它适用于静态、固定长度数据集合,例如字符串数组或整数数组。...CursorAdapter:CursorAdapter适用于使用数据库查询结果作为数据情况。它将数据库查询结果封装为Cursor对象,并将数据与ListView绑定。...通过继承BaseAdapter,并覆写其中方法,可以实现完全定制化适配器,包括列表项视图数据绑定过程。

    57810

    Springmvc工作原理详解

    MVC 每个部分各司其职: Model(模型) : 通常指就是我们数据模型。作用一般情况下用于封装数据。 View(视图) : 通常指就是我们 jsp 或者 html。...作用一般就是展示数据。 通常视图是依据模型数据创建。 Controller(控制器) : 是应用程序处理用户交互部分。 作用一般就是处理程序逻辑。...)和方法url(method上@RequestMapping值),与requesturl进行匹配,找到匹配那个方法; 确定处理请求method后,接下来任务就是参数绑定,把request参数绑定到方法形式参数上...springmvc提供了两种request参数与方法形参绑定方法: ① 通过注解进行绑定,@RequestParam ②通过参数名称进行绑定.使用注解进行绑定,我们只要在方法参数前面声明@RequestParam...(“a”),就可以将request参数a绑定到方法参数上.使用参数名称进行绑定前提是必须要获取方法参数名称,Java反射只提供了获取方法参数类型,并没有提供获取参数名称方法.springmvc

    73920

    SpringMVC简介和工作流程「建议收藏」

    强大而直接配置方式:将框架类和应用程序类都能作为JavaBean配置,支持跨多个context引用,例如,在web控制器对业务对象和验证器(validator)引用。...可定制绑定(binding) 和验证(validation):比如将类型不匹配作为应用级验证错误, 这可以保存错误值。再比如本地化日期和数字绑定等等。...简单而强大JSP标签库(SpringTag Library):支持包括诸如数据绑定和主题(theme) 之类许多功能。...非常灵活数据验证、格式化和数据绑定机制 支持Restful风格 5、SpringMVC入门程序 web.xml <!...而每个方法同时又何一个url对应,参数传递是直接注入到方法,是方法所独有的。

    88720

    JVM精通面试系列 | 掘金技术征文

    动态绑定是采用什么实现 Java 虚拟机采取了一种用空间换取时间策略,通过方法表这一数据结构来实现。方法表每一个重写方法索引值,与父类方法表中被重写方法索引值一致。...invoke是如何实现自动适配参数类型 invoke 会调用 MethodHandle.asType 方法,生成一个适配器方法句 柄,对传入参数进行适配,再调用原方法句柄。...增操作会往传入参数插入额外参数,再调用另一个方法句柄,它对应 API 是 MethodHandle.bindTo 方法。...这个特有的适配器会将方法句柄作为常量,直接获取其 MemberName类型字段,并继 续后面的 linkToStatic 调用。...如何查看一个类具体适配器类 可以通过虚拟机参数 -Djdk.internal.lambda.dumpProxyClasses=/DUMP/PATH 导出这些 具体适配器类。

    80520
    领券